i'm trying to copy files accross a win98 network, these files have french characters in them. i get the error cannot copy file.
files have characters such as é, ë, â
i have put on all the win98 updates, it copies all other types of files. if i rename the files, they copy. but this is not an option as there are 100's of files and new ones created all the time.
